/*
* C++ Design Patterns: Proxy
* Author: Jakub Vojvoda [github.com/JakubVojvoda]
* 2016
*
* Source code is licensed under MIT License
* (for more details see LICENSE)
*
*/
#include <iostream>
/*
* Subject
* defines the common interface for RealSubject and Proxy
* so that a Proxy can be used anywhere a RealSubject is expected
*/
class Subject
{
public:
virtual ~Subject() { /* ... */ }
virtual void request() = 0;
// ...
};
/*
* Real Subject
* defines the real object that the proxy represents
*/
class RealSubject : public Subject
{
public:
void request()
{
std::cout << "Real Subject request" << std::endl;
}
// ...
};
/*
* Proxy
* maintains a reference that lets the proxy access the real subject
*/
class Proxy : public Subject
{
public:
Proxy()
{
subject = new RealSubject();
}
~Proxy()
{
delete subject;
}
void request()
{
subject->request();
}
// ...
private:
RealSubject *subject;
};
int main()
{
Proxy *proxy = new Proxy();
proxy->request();
delete proxy;
return 0;
}
